例如,不要在@node-click事件后添加.stop或.prevent等修饰符,除非确实需要。 查看官方文档: 查看Element UI官方文档中关于el-tree组件的node-click事件的说明,确认用法是否正确。同时,检查你所使用的Element UI版本是否有相关的bug或更新说明,这些可能会影响node-click事件的行为。 搜索类似问题: 如果以上步骤都无法...
-node-method="filterNode" @node-click="handleXmxz" ref="tree3"> </el-tree> </el-popover> handleXmxz:function(obj, node, data){ if(node.data.type!=0&&node.data.type!=1)return; $(".xmxz-container").parent("div").hide() showRight(node.data.type)//新项目 } element-uivue...
@select="handlefilterNode" // 在点击下拉框后触发函数,可写入请求搜索树后台接口 @keyup.enter.native="handlefilterNode" // 设置回车键 > </el-autocomplete> 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11. 12. 13. 14. 15. 16. 17. 搜索使用了autocomplete组件,对其做一些设置,模仿百度搜索的功...
<el-tree ref="GridTree" node-key="_id" lazy highlight-current :props="defaultProps" :load="loadNode" :current-node-key="currentNodeKey" :expand-on-click-node="false" :default-expanded-keys="defaultExpand" @node-click="handleNodeClick" ></el-tree> async loadNode (node, resolve) { ...
最后如果非要用el-tree的话,你说的传参不知道是不是我理解的点击select中的值,el-tree中的高亮,如果是的话,可以使用setCurrentKey方法 有用 回复 撰写回答 你尚未登录,登录后可以 和开发者交流问题的细节 关注并接收问题和回答的更新提醒 参与内容的编辑和改进,让解决方法与时俱进 注册登录...
在使用el-tree时,在created时使用getNode尝试获取节点 打印发现获取不到,猜测是treeData还没加载出来,在getNode前打印treeData 发现t...
<el-tree node-key="areaPlaceId" :default-expanded-keys="['532822']" accordion class="tree" :data="data" highlight-current lazy :load="loadNode" :props="defaultProps" @node-click="handleNodeClick" > </el-tree> </el-menu> </el-aside> ...
$api.getTreeChildData(params); return resolve(res.data); }, // 点击树组件节点上的添加或未添加按钮,更改树的添加未添加的状态,同时追加或删除右侧表格中对应的行的数据 changeStatus(node, data) { // console.log("data是点击的这个树节点所绑定的数据", data); if (data.status == "0") { ...
在elementui el-tree 组件中,通过设置 node-key 属性,我们可以使用上述字段组合来标识树中的节点。当节点发生变化时,我们可以通过 node-key 属性来准确地找到对应的节点,进行后续操作。 总之,node-key 属性是 elementui el-tree 组件中用于指定唯一标识树节点的字段组合,可以根据实际需求设置不同的组合方式来确保每...